Local Job Search Strategies in Hickory
Hickory’s employment landscape offers multiple pathways for career growth beyond traditional applications. Two effective approaches combine hands-on learning with strategic platform use.
Exploring Apprenticeships and Internships
North Carolina’s Community College System operates ApprenticeshipNC, blending paid work experience with classroom training. Participants gain certifications in fields like advanced manufacturing while earning wages. For example, skilled trades apprenticeships often lead to full-time roles within 12-24 months.
The state internship program provides 400 hours of paid professional experience at $12/hour. Applications open each January for summer placements. Highlight relevant coursework and soft skills when applying.
Utilizing State and Community Job Boards
NCWorks Online gives veterans 24-hour early access to new listings. Create alerts for “maintenance technician” or similar roles to receive instant notifications. The platform also lists free certification programs through local community colleges.
For specialized positions like industrial roles, filter searches by “veteran-preferred” employers. Update your profile weekly to maintain visibility in recruiter searches.

Community Resources and Networking for Employment Success
Building career success extends beyond applications – local networks and specialized programs create pathways to stable employment. Hickory’s community resources offer tailored solutions for veterans, youth, and those rebuilding careers.
Accessing Veterans, Youth, and Reentry Support Services
NCWorks Career Centers provide veteran-specific career assessments and 24-hour early access to new listings. Specialized staff – many former military – help translate service skills to civilian roles. One veteran recently secured a logistics position by highlighting leadership experience from their customized resume.
Youth programs connect ages 14-24 with paid internships at local manufacturers. Participants gain OSHA certifications while earning $14/hour. Reentry services assist with employer policy navigation and federal bonding program connections, reducing hiring risks for businesses.
Connecting with Local Businesses and Agricultural Opportunities
Agricultural consultants match workers with seasonal roles at apple orchards and dairy farms. They coordinate housing and transportation for migrant laborers during peak harvest months. Local growers often hire through NCWorks’ specialized job fairs.
Workforce development boards fund forklift training for warehouse roles. Partner employers like Hickory Chair Company prioritize graduates for full-time positions. Transportation vouchers and childcare referrals remove common barriers to employment stability.

Are there apprenticeship programs for skilled trades in Hickory?
Yes. Catawba Valley Community College partners with manufacturers like Flexsteel Industries to offer paid apprenticeships in CNC machining, welding, and advanced manufacturing.
How can veterans access employment support services?
The NCWorks Career Center provides dedicated case management, skills assessments, and interview prep through their Veterans Services division. Partner organizations like Goodwill Industries offer additional resources.
